1. The Rise of AI in Education

AI in education refers to the use of intelligent systems that can process data, learn patterns, and make decisions or predictions to support teaching and learning. While basic forms of edtech—like digital whiteboards and LMS platforms—have existed for years, recent advancements in generative AI, natural language processing, and predictive analytics have made transformative use cases mainstream.

For example, AI tools like ChatGPT can support students in drafting essays, answering questions, and generating study summaries. At the same time, learning platforms are evolving to include adaptive assessments, virtual teaching assistants, and custom lesson plan generators.

This technological evolution is not only enhancing individual learning but also providing educators with insights into student performance at an unprecedented scale.

2. Benefits of AI for Educators and Learners

Personalised Learning at Scale

AI algorithms can adapt to individual student needs. A student struggling with a specific topic can receive targeted resources, while a high-achieving learner might be challenged with more complex material. For example, adaptive quizzes adjust their difficulty level based on the student’s previous answers.

Time-Saving for Educators

Educators can automate repetitive tasks like grading multiple-choice assessments, generating feedback, and creating differentiated materials. For instance, an AI tool could automatically generate reading comprehension questions based on an uploaded text.

Enhanced Learning Analytics

Educators gain real-time access to dashboards showing class performance, engagement levels, and predictive risk alerts for learners who may be falling behind.

Equitable Access and Inclusion

AI-powered translation and speech-to-text tools are improving accessibility for students with disabilities or language barriers, making learning more inclusive.

3. Challenges and Ethical Considerations

Despite its benefits, AI in education also raises complex ethical and operational challenges.

  • Bias in Algorithms: AI tools trained on skewed data can perpetuate inequalities, for example, offering better recommendations to certain demographic groups.
  • Data Privacy and Consent: Student data is sensitive. Institutions must ensure compliance with data protection laws like FERPA or GDPR.
  • Over-reliance and De-skilling: Excessive use of AI may reduce critical thinking or teaching autonomy if not balanced appropriately.
  • Digital Divide: Access to AI tools requires infrastructure something not equally available to all students or schools.

These issues require proactive governance, training, and policy development at both classroom and institutional levels.

4. Key Areas of Transformation

AI-Enhanced Assessments

AI enables continuous formative assessments. For example, students writing essays can receive real-time grammar feedback, while teachers receive analytical summaries of writing patterns and complexity.

Intelligent Tutoring Systems

Virtual teaching assistants simulate one-on-one tutoring, offering explanations, questions, and encouragement without human supervision.

Learning Analytics

By analysing engagement patterns, clickstreams, and quiz scores, AI can identify struggling students and recommend interventions early.

Course Design Automation

Some platforms now use AI to auto-generate content outlines, quiz banks, and lesson plan structures from basic prompts, significantly reducing prep time for faculty.

5. Role of Faculty and Staff in AI-Integrated Environments

Educators are at the core of AI adoption. While AI can enhance the learning process, its effectiveness depends on how well it’s integrated into pedagogical strategies.

  • Training Needs: Faculty need structured exposure to prompt engineering, AI feedback systems, and evaluation tools.
  • Mindset Shift: Instead of viewing AI as a replacement, educators should see it as a co-pilot that amplifies their creativity and productivity.
  • Curriculum Alignment: Academic programmes must incorporate AI literacy, data ethics, and critical digital thinking as core competencies.

Consider a university that introduces an AI Teaching Assistant in its business faculty. Faculty not only use it to manage discussions but also reframe assignments to focus on decision-making and synthesis rather than memorisation.

6. What’s Next? Trends to Watch

The landscape is evolving rapidly. Here are three transformational trends on the horizon:

  • Agentic AI: Systems that help students develop metacognition by prompting reflection, planning, and self-regulation.
  • Digital Twins in Education: Virtual replicas of learners or classrooms used to test interventions or learning strategies.
  • Autonomous Learning Systems: Self-driven platforms where students navigate learning journeys with minimal human input ideal for lifelong or remote learning.

These innovations hint at a future where education is more personalised, self-directed, and seamlessly supported by smart systems.
